Hunter Hills, Winston-Salem, NC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Hunter Hills?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Hunter Hills Studio Apartments | $796 | $699 | $845 |
| Hunter Hills 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,067 | $750 | $1,790 |
Hunter Hills 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,228 | $900 | $2,030 |
| Hunter Hills 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,527 | $1,170 | $1,910 |
| Hunter Hills 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,332 | $900 | $3,600 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Hunter Hills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Hunter Hills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Hunter Hills is $1,228.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Hunter Hills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Hunter Hills is a 1,326 square feet unit starting from $1,295 at The Pines at Bethabara.
What is the average size for Hunter Hills 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Hunter Hills is currently 1,000 sq ft.
